Handy Website Optimization Techniques: Enhancing Performance and User Experience

Handy Website Optimization Techniques: Enhancing Performance and User Experience

In today’s digital age, a strong online presence is crucial for businesses to succeed. One essential component of this online presence is a well-designed and professionally developed website. Not only does a website provide information about your products or services, but it also serves as

Date Posted

Author

Category

android connecting dots

In today’s digital age, having a well-optimized website is essential for attracting and retaining visitors. Website optimization techniques not only improve your site’s performance but also enhance the overall user experience. In this blog post, Big Beard Web Solutions will help you explore several handy techniques that can help you optimize your website, ensuring faster loading times, better search engine rankings and increased user engagement. Let’s dive in and unlock the potential of your website!

 

Compress and Optimize Images

 

Images can significantly impact a website’s loading speed. By compressing and optimizing images without sacrificing quality, you can reduce file sizes and improve load times. Use tools like Photoshop or online compressors to optimize your images before uploading them, ensuring a faster and smoother browsing experience for your visitors.

 

Enable Browser Caching

 

Browser caching allows a user’s browser to store certain elements of your website, such as images, CSS and JavaScript files, in a temporary storage space. This enables faster subsequent visits to your site, as the browser doesn’t need to request and download the same files repeatedly. Enabling browser caching can be easily done by adding cache-control headers or using plugins if you’re using a content management system (CMS) like WordPress.

 

Minify CSS, JavaScript and HTML

 

Minifying involves removing unnecessary characters, like whitespace and comments, from your CSS, JavaScript and HTML files. Minified files are smaller in size and load faster, contributing to a more streamlined website performance. Consider using minification tools or plugins to automate this process and ensure that your code is clean and optimized.

 

Optimize Your Website’s Code and Scripts

 

Reviewing and optimizing your website’s code and scripts can help improve performance. Remove unnecessary or deprecated code, consolidate and streamline JavaScript and CSS files, and ensure that your code follows best practices. Optimized code reduces file sizes and decreases the time it takes for your website to load.

 

 Implement Responsive Design

 

In the age of mobile browsing, having a responsive website design is paramount. Responsive design ensures that your website adapts and looks great on different devices and screen sizes. It not only improves user experience, but also contributes to better search engine rankings, as search engines prioritize mobile-friendly sites. Use responsive design frameworks or consult a web developer to make your site responsive.

 

Improve Website Navigation and Structure

 

User-friendly navigation and a clear website structure are crucial for a positive user experience. Ensure that your site has a logical hierarchy, with easily accessible menus and clear pathways to important sections and information. Make use of breadcrumbs, internal linking and descriptive anchor texts to guide users and make it easier for them to navigate your website.

 

Optimize Page Speed and Loading Times

 

Website speed is a critical factor for user satisfaction and search engine rankings. Test your website’s speed using online tools like Google PageSpeed Insights or GTmetrix. Identify areas for improvement, such as reducing server response time, optimizing CSS and JavaScript delivery, or leveraging browser caching (as mentioned earlier). By addressing these issues, you can significantly improve your website’s loading times.

 

Regularly Update and Optimize Content

 

Keeping your website content up to date and optimized is essential for maintaining consistent traffic and search engine visibility. Regularly refresh your content with new information, images and videos. Optimize your content for SEO by using relevant keywords, writing compelling meta tags and ensuring that your content is easily readable and scannable. This will improve your website’s visibility in search engine results and attract more organic traffic.

 

Conclusion

 

Optimizing your website is an ongoing process that can yield significant benefits in terms of performance, user experience and search engine visibility. By implementing handy techniques such as compressing images, enabling browser caching, minifying code, implementing responsive design, improving navigation and structure, optimizing page speed and regularly updating content, you can ensure that your website operates at its full potential. Take the time to implement these techniques, and watch as your website becomes faster, more engaging and more successful in achieving your goals.

 

Tags

 

Big Beard Web Solutions, Bigger Beardlier Best, Level 1 BBBEE, Website Design, Website Development, Website Support, Website Maintenance, Copywriting, WordPress, SMME, Entrepreneurship, South Africa’s Digital Revolution

 

Legend has it that the beards of prehistoric humans were so thick and rich, that they could cushion blows to the face!  Which is why at Big Beard Web Solutions, we fortify your website by putting a beard on it. Get in touch to make your online presence Bigger. Beardlier. Best.

Related Articles

Check out the experiences we make and live at Big Beard. Read more about our process & clients and get fresh tips and tricks.

10 min read

10 min read

Join our mailing list to get updates and information

Join our mailing list to get updates and information

"*" indicates required fields